JAPANESE MAN ACQUITTED OF 1966 MURDERS AWARDED US$1.44 MILLION

25/03/2025 02:16 PM

SHIZUOKA (Japan), March 25 (Bernama-Kyodo) -- Iwao Hakamata, 89, acquitted in a retrial over a 1966 family murder in Japan, has been awarded record criminal compensation after spending over 47 years in prison, Kyodo News Agency reported on Tuesday.

His legal team said the order to pay around ¥217 million (US$1.44 million) was issued by the Shizuoka District Court on Monday, stating that the compensation was granted for his more than four decades of physical detention, from his arrest until his release.

In January, the team submitted a compensation claim to the district court on behalf of Hakamata, who still suffers from the effects of his confinement.

Hakamata's acquittal was finalised last October, marking the end of his family's decades-long fight to free him from death row. Investigative authorities fabricated evidence in the case, which took place in Shizuoka Prefecture, according to the court.

The fabrication served as the "basis for determining the amount of compensation," the court said, with the presiding judge noting Hakamata spent about 33 years of his detention under a death sentence, causing him to endure "extremely severe" mental and physical pain.

Hakamata's legal team has said it plans to file a lawsuit against Shizuoka Prefecture and the national government by this summer to hold them accountable for the wrongful conviction.

At a press conference in the prefecture, one of Hakamata's lawyers said, "It is only natural for the highest amount of criminal compensation to be awarded in a death penalty case where fabrication has been acknowledged."

Referring to the lingering effects of Hakamata's confinement, the lawyer criticised the central government, saying it had committed a "wrongdoing that 200 million yen cannot possibly atone for."
